What did the short stories of the Ming Dynasty reflect?

2024-09-17 14:17
2024-09-17 18:03

The vernacular short stories of the Ming Dynasty reflected the content of the Ming Dynasty society, including the following aspects: 1. Social customs: The short stories of the Ming Dynasty often describe the customs and habits of the society at that time, such as weddings, funerals, festivals, etc. These descriptions reflected the living conditions and mentality of the people at that time. 2. Character: The description of the characters in the vernacular short stories of the Ming Dynasty is also very rich. Through the description of the character's personality, behavior and thoughts, it shows the character's personality and spiritual outlook of the society at that time. 3. Commercial economy: The Ming Dynasty was an important period for the development of China's commercial economy. The vernacular short stories often described the content of the commercial economy, such as merchants, trade, shops, etc. 4. War and military affairs: The Ming Dynasty was one of the most frequent periods of war in Chinese history, so the vernacular short stories often described war and military content such as generals, troops, battles, etc. 5. Religious culture: The Ming Dynasty was an important period for the development of Chinese religious culture. Therefore, the content of religious culture such as temples, immortals, monsters, etc. was often described in vernacular short stories.
